Online Estimate and Compensation of the Gear Machining Error Based on Flexible Electronic Gearbox
Electronic gearbox (EGB) is mainly used for controlling of the generating and differential movements in the gear machining tools.This paper mainly focuses on online estimate and compensation of the gear machining error based on flexible electronic gearbox.Firstly, the reasons of helical gear pitch error and spiral line contour error are analyzed, which caused by the machine tool body manufacturing and assembly errors, thermal deformation, cutting force and vibration.Then, the error models of helical gear pitch error and spiral line contour error are constructed.Finally, the weight coefficients of each axis impact on the gear generating machining error are determined, combined with the multi-axis cross coupling control method.The cross coupling control compensation model of EGB is designed to improve the EGB control effect.
